Great for classical and rock-not great for EDM

Works better than the version my friend has from 2 years ago. I'd say it has about 50% more bass. It's good enough for a lot music, but if you really love bass heavy music like R&B, funk, EDM or dubstep -you will probably be disappointed even at max volume. I enjoy EDM etc, but I switch to my 2019 Sony WH-1000XM3 when I want to listen to bass heavy music.

I only give this three

I only give this three stars because although it has its practical use of being able to listen through the headphones while also being able to hear what's going on around you. However, you cannot turn the volume up past a certain medium/low level because any louder causes an annoying vibration against the contact area next to your ear. Listening to talking such as a podcast or your navigation is great, but you cannot enjoy music. I would recommend sticking to in ear buds if that is why you want earphones.
